A pyrometer is a non-contact thermometer used to measure high temperatures. It works by measuring the amount of infrared radiation emitted by an object. Pyrometers are often used in metallurgical furnaces to measure the temperature of molten metals.
A thermocouple is a temperature sensor that converts temperature to an electrical voltage. It is made of two dissimilar metals that are joined together at one end. When the temperature at the junction changes, an electric current is generated. Thermocouples are often used in industrial applications to measure temperatures up to 2,000 degrees Celsius.
A thermometer is a device for measuring temperature. It is typically made of glass and contains a liquid that expands and contracts with changes in temperature. Thermometers are often used to measure human body temperature, but they can also be used to measure the temperature of other objects.
A thermistor is a type of resistor that changes its resistance with changes in temperature. Thermistors are often used in temperature sensors and thermostats.
